Output e127ed0ba93123e65a2f4b171721308906949f13ad239e23bb00c52862bfd9a4:9

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ddcf9d0df55519336f0417edf00e39c627bfff97 OP_EQUAL
address
3MuqyBCqEF4ZjuY4h7k2F3MSJZYCEgVNwt
transaction
e127ed0ba93123e65a2f4b171721308906949f13ad239e23bb00c52862bfd9a4
spent
true